So, you’ve finally got your hands on a PlayStation 5 or Xbox Series X here in South Africa. Awesome! But are you still plugging it into that old 60Hz TV? If so, you're leaving a massive amount of performance on the table. A high refresh rate monitor for console gaming isn't just a luxury for PC pros anymore; it's the key to unlocking the true speed and responsiveness your next-gen console was built for.
For years, 60 frames per second (fps) at 60Hz was the gold standard. But modern consoles can now push out up to 120fps in many popular titles. When your screen can only refresh 60 times per second (60Hz), you’re literally missing half the frames your console is producing.
Upgrading to a 120Hz or 144Hz monitor means you see every single one of those frames. The difference is night and day:

Before you can enjoy those high frame rates, you need to ensure your setup is correctly configured. It’s not quite plug-and-play, but it’s simple once you know what to look for.
Your console's HDMI port is crucial. The PS5 and Xbox Series X ship with an HDMI 2.1 port, which is the gold standard for delivering a 4K resolution signal at 120Hz. If you want the absolute best visual quality without compromise, pairing your console with one of the latest 4K gaming monitors featuring an HDMI 2.1 port is the way to go.
However, you don't need HDMI 2.1 to get a 120Hz experience. Many fantastic 1080p and 1440p monitors use the more common HDMI 2.0 standard, which is fully capable of handling 120Hz at those resolutions. This is often the sweet spot for budget-conscious gamers in South Africa.
that enabling 120Hz on your console is only half the battle! Many games like Call of Duty: Warzone or Fortnite require you to switch to a 'Performance Mode' within the game's own video settings. Always check in-game options to ensure you're actually getting that buttery-smooth 120fps experience.

Other specs are just as important for a top-tier experience.
Look for a monitor with a 1ms (GtG) response time. This minimises "ghosting," a blurry trail that can appear behind fast-moving objects. Most high-performance PC monitors suitable for consoles will use IPS or VA panels, which offer a great balance of speed and vibrant colour.
While 4K is amazing, a 27-inch 1440p (QHD) monitor is often the perfect balance of sharpness, performance, and price. If you prefer a more immersive feel, some gamers swear by curved monitors to fill their peripheral vision.
VRR, often known as AMD FreeSync or NVIDIA G-Sync, syncs your monitor's refresh rate with your console's frame rate. This eliminates ugly screen tearing and stuttering, ensuring the smoothest gameplay possible. Both the PS5 and Xbox Series X|S support VRR, so it’s a feature well worth having. Yes, for consoles like the PS5 and Xbox Series X/S. A high refresh rate monitor (120Hz or higher) is essential to unlock 120FPS modes for ultra-smooth gameplay.
Most can, but it's crucial to check for an HDMI 2.0 or 2.1 port. HDMI 2.1 is needed for 4K at 120Hz, while HDMI 2.0 supports 1080p or 1440p at 120Hz.
For current consoles, 120Hz is the target. A 144Hz monitor works perfectly as it can easily display 120Hz, giving you a slight buffer and future-proofing your setup.
The best refresh rate for a PS5 monitor is at least 120Hz. This allows you to enable "Performance Mode" in supported games for the smoothest possible visual experience.
Absolutely. Higher refresh rates reduce motion blur and input lag, making aiming more precise and movements feel more responsive, giving you a clear competitive advantage.
